CVE:CVE-2011-1430 |
vulnerable | 2026-06-03 14:31:01.446218 |
Details available
The STARTTLS implementation in the server in Ipswitch IMail 11.03 and earlier does not properly restrict I/O buffering,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to insert commands into encrypted SMTP sessions by sending a cleartext command that is processed after TLS is in place, related to a "plaintext command injection" attack, a similar issue to CVE-2011-0411.
Published: 2011-03-16T22:00:00.000Z
Updated: 2024-08-06T22:28:41.210Z |

CVE:CVE-2005-1256 |
vulnerable | 2026-06-03 14:26:58.554053 |
Details available
Stack-based buffer overflow in the IMAP daemon (IMAPD32.EXE) in IMail 8.13 in Ipswitch Collaboration Suite (ICS), and other versions before IMail Server 8.2 Hotfix 2, allows remote authenticated users to execute arbitrary code via a STATUS command with a long mailbox name.
Published: 2005-05-25T04:00:00.000Z
Updated: 2024-08-07T21:44:05.453Z |

CVE:CVE-2005-1255 |
vulnerable | 2026-06-03 14:26:58.553535 |
Details available
Multiple stack-based buffer overflows in the IMAP server in IMail 8.12 and 8.13 in Ipswitch Collaboration Suite (ICS), and other versions before IMail Server 8.2 Hotfix 2, all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a LOGIN command with (1) a long username argument or (2) a long username argument that begins with a special character.
Published: 2005-05-25T04:00:00.000Z
Updated: 2024-08-07T21:44:06.254Z |

CVE:CVE-2005-1254 |
vulnerable | 2026-06-03 14:26:58.552922 |
Details available
Stack-based buffer overflow in the IMAP server for Ipswitch IMail 8.12 and 8.13, and other versions before IMail Server 8.2 Hotfix 2, allows remote authenticated users to cause a denial of service (crash) via a SELECT command with a large argument.
Published: 2005-05-25T04:00:00.000Z
Updated: 2024-08-07T21:44:05.964Z |

CVE:CVE-2005-1252 |
vulnerable | 2026-06-03 14:26:58.547786 |
Details available
Directory traversal vulnerability in the Web Calendaring server in Ipswitch Imail 8.13, and other versions before IMail Server 8.2 Hotfix 2, allows remote attackers to read arbitrary files via "..\" (dot dot backslash) sequences in the query string argument in a GET request to a non-existent .jsp file.
Published: 2005-05-25T04:00:00.000Z
Updated: 2024-08-07T21:44:05.691Z |

CVE:CVE-2004-1520 |
vulnerable | 2026-06-03 14:26:39.963449 |
Details available
Stack-based buffer overflow in IPSwitch IMail 8.13 allows remote authenticated users to execute arbitrary code via a long IMAP DELETE command.
Published: 2005-02-19T05:00:00.000Z
Updated: 2024-08-08T00:53:24.077Z |
